The film, directed by Ben Rekhi and produced by Rana Daggubati‘s Spirit Media, will mark the first time Bajpayee and co-star Boman Irani have shared the screen. Adapted from Adiga’s novel of the same name – the author also wrote Booker-winning “The White Tiger” – the screenplay was written by Sooni Taraporevala, with Hindi-language dialogue by Juhi Chaturvedi. Divya Dutta completes the principal trio, with Sukant Goel also in the cast.

The story follows Masterji, a retired schoolteacher whose refusal to go along with those around him places him in direct conflict with his own community. His act of quiet resistance ripples outward, throwing into relief the choices and compromises of neighbors – including Mrs. Puri – as an offer of change tests what each of them is willing to hold on to.

Rekhi said: “It’s been a deeply fulfilling experience bringing ‘Last Man in Tower’ to life with an incredible team top to bottom, from Rana Daggubati producing, to Sooni Taraporevala scripting, all based on Aravind Adiga’s incredible book. The most rewarding part has been witnessing the power of Manoj and Boman – two giants of cinema – working together for the first time in this film. Divya brings an incredible depth and emotional strength to the ensemble, and the combination of these three actors makes the world of the film particularly special.

Daggubati said: “‘Last Man in Tower’ is a deeply human story. What drew us to it was how naturally it finds something universal in the lives of a very specific group of people. There is something very compelling about the way it explores the choices we make and the things we hold on to.

The entire ensemble of cast led by Manoj, Divya, and Boman bring an incredible depth to their characters.
